Master of Arts in Teaching English to Speakers of Other Languages at NEIU Chicago Entry Requirements
- No specific cutoff mentioned
- CGPA - 2.75/4
- Applicant must hold a Bachelor’s degree from a regionally-accredited university with undergraduate GPA of 2.75 or greater on a 4-point scale
- Students entering the M.A. in TESOL program are not expected to have any prior preparation or knowledge of the field

Master of Arts in Teaching English to Speakers of Other Languages at NEIU Chicago Application Process
- Official transcripts are required from all colleges and universities attended
- Submit a two-page statement addressing your goals and objectives specific to the program to which you are applying
- Proof of English langauge proficiency
- GRE/GMAT scores, if required
- Bank letter(s) from each sponsor’s financial institution, if any
- Copy of passport photo page
- Financial statements
- Payment can be made in three or four equal installments in each semester
Master of Arts in Teaching English to Speakers of Other Languages at NEIU Chicago Highlights
- The M.A. in Teaching English to Speakers of Other Languages gives students an understanding of the nature of language, culture, instruction, assessment, and professionalism, and their interrelationships
- The M.A. in TESOL prepares one to teach English in the US or overseas. In addition, students who have a valid teaching certificate can take courses leading to the Illinois State Endorsement to teach ESL
- The program is designed for full- or part-time students, and all master’s level courses in the fall and spring are offered in the evenings
